How can you learn what your users like about your application and what you can do to make it better? Enter user research! While at NDC London, Carl and Richard talked to Lily Dart about her approaches to doing user research - guerrilla style! Lily talks about being out on street corners asking passersby to look at an application on a smartphone and give their impressions, all for a Starbucks card. The trick is not to take what they say literally, but to actually watch how they interact with the application, what works and what doesn't. In some apps, the camera is always on so they can record the facial expressions of the tester!
